Last Exile
Summary
Last Exile is an anime television series[1]. It has Wikipedia articles in 17 language editions, a strong signal of global cultural recognition.[2]
Key Facts
- Last Exile's instance of is recorded as anime television series[3].
- Last Exile was directed by Koichi Chigira[4].
- Last Exile's genre is fantasy anime and manga[5].
- Last Exile's genre is adventure anime and manga[6].
- The original language of Last Exile was Japanese[7].
- Last Exile was distributed by video on demand[8].
- Last Exile's original broadcaster is recorded as TV Tokyo[9].
- Last Exile's country of origin is recorded as Japan[10].
- Last Exile began on April 7, 2003[11].
